bool SMBNTLMv2encrypt_hash(TALLOC_CTX *mem_ctx,
			   const char *user, const char *domain, const uint8_t nt_hash[16],
			   const DATA_BLOB *server_chal,
			   const DATA_BLOB *names_blob,
			   DATA_BLOB *lm_response, DATA_BLOB *nt_response,
			   DATA_BLOB *lm_session_key, DATA_BLOB *user_session_key)
{
	uint8_t ntlm_v2_hash[16];

	/* We don't use the NT# directly.  Instead we use it mashed up with
	   the username and domain.
	   This prevents username swapping during the auth exchange
	*/
	if (!ntv2_owf_gen(nt_hash, user, domain, ntlm_v2_hash)) {
		return false;
	}

	if (nt_response) {
		*nt_response = NTLMv2_generate_response(mem_ctx,
							ntlm_v2_hash, server_chal,
							names_blob);
		if (user_session_key) {
			*user_session_key = data_blob_talloc(mem_ctx, NULL, 16);

			/* The NTLMv2 calculations also provide a session key, for signing etc later */
			/* use only the first 16 bytes of nt_response for session key */
			SMBsesskeygen_ntv2(ntlm_v2_hash, nt_response->data, user_session_key->data);
		}
	}

	/* LMv2 */

	if (lm_response) {
		*lm_response = LMv2_generate_response(mem_ctx,
						      ntlm_v2_hash, server_chal);
		if (lm_session_key) {
			*lm_session_key = data_blob_talloc(mem_ctx, NULL, 16);

			/* The NTLMv2 calculations also provide a session key, for signing etc later */
			/* use only the first 16 bytes of lm_response for session key */
			SMBsesskeygen_ntv2(ntlm_v2_hash, lm_response->data, lm_session_key->data);
		}
	}

	return true;
}

static bool smb_pwd_check_ntlmv2(TALLOC_CTX *mem_ctx,
				 const DATA_BLOB *ntv2_response,
				 const uint8_t *part_passwd,
				 const DATA_BLOB *sec_blob,
				 const char *user, const char *domain,
				 DATA_BLOB *user_sess_key)
{
	/* Finish the encryption of part_passwd. */
	uint8_t kr[16];
	uint8_t value_from_encryption[16];
	DATA_BLOB client_key_data;

	if (part_passwd == NULL) {
		DEBUG(10,("No password set - DISALLOWING access\n"));
		/* No password set - always false */
		return false;
	}

	if (sec_blob->length != 8) {
		DEBUG(0, ("smb_pwd_check_ntlmv2: incorrect challenge size (%lu)\n", 
			  (unsigned long)sec_blob->length));
		return false;
	}

	if (ntv2_response->length < 24) {
		/* We MUST have more than 16 bytes, or the stuff below will go
		   crazy.  No known implementation sends less than the 24 bytes
		   for LMv2, let alone NTLMv2. */
		DEBUG(0, ("smb_pwd_check_ntlmv2: incorrect password length (%lu)\n", 
			  (unsigned long)ntv2_response->length));
		return false;
	}

	client_key_data = data_blob_talloc(mem_ctx, ntv2_response->data+16, ntv2_response->length-16);
	/* 
	   todo:  should we be checking this for anything?  We can't for LMv2, 
	   but for NTLMv2 it is meant to contain the current time etc.
	*/

	if (!ntv2_owf_gen(part_passwd, user, domain, kr)) {
		return false;
	}

	SMBOWFencrypt_ntv2(kr, sec_blob, &client_key_data, value_from_encryption);

#if DEBUG_PASSWORD
	DEBUG(100,("Part password (P16) was |\n"));
	dump_data(100, part_passwd, 16);
	DEBUGADD(100,("Password from client was |\n"));
	dump_data(100, ntv2_response->data, ntv2_response->length);
	DEBUGADD(100,("Variable data from client was |\n"));
	dump_data(100, client_key_data.data, client_key_data.length);
	DEBUGADD(100,("Given challenge was |\n"));
	dump_data(100, sec_blob->data, sec_blob->length);
	DEBUGADD(100,("Value from encryption was |\n"));
	dump_data(100, value_from_encryption, 16);
#endif
	data_blob_clear_free(&client_key_data);
	if (memcmp(value_from_encryption, ntv2_response->data, 16) == 0) { 
		if (user_sess_key != NULL) {
			*user_sess_key = data_blob_talloc(mem_ctx, NULL, 16);
			SMBsesskeygen_ntv2(kr, value_from_encryption, user_sess_key->data);
		}
		return true;
	}
	return false;
}
